Handspring announced that the Treo 300 has captured the Computer Reseller News, Best New Product of 2002 award. Competing in the handheld PC category against it were the Toshiba e740, Sony CLIE PEG-NX70V, ViewSonic V35, RIM Blackberry 6710, and HP iPaq 5450. Of note here is that the majority of these products have integrated wireless communications.

Computer Reseller News is focused on aspects of a product that make it valuable to a reseller. In a link off of the award page, you will find a CRN article about the use of Treo 300 in vertical markets.
"A well-designed handheld/phone hybrid that operates on the Palm OS, the Treo 300 has a bright color display, 16 Mbytes of memory and an easy-to-use built-in thumb keyboard. The 300 model is smaller than an average PDA and a bit larger than a typical cell phone. The Treo uses a single slot for syncing to a host PC and recharging, and it has an impressive battery life."
